Output df32efe368739cc8d30583485f2031dcb425a68c5ecefa14abcfbfcf6b0692fc:139

value
311014
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39aa8af7b4a90c3a4d184ab1053a2ea65c5eed0f OP_EQUALVERIFY OP_CHECKSIG
address
16FupTcDikKWf49EAa8ihscvVohp7L2SnK
transaction
df32efe368739cc8d30583485f2031dcb425a68c5ecefa14abcfbfcf6b0692fc
confirmations
112140
spent
true